The majority race in Chugach Census Area overall is white, making up 67.8% of residents. The next most-common racial group is other at 10.1%. There are more white people in the northeast areas of the county. People who identify as other are most likely to be living in the east places. Diversity and Diversity Scores for Chugach Census Area, AK
The map below shows diversity in Chugach Census Area. Areas in green are more diverse, while areas in red are much less diverse. Diversity, in this case, means a mixture of people with different race and ethnicity living close to one another. For example, all-black and all-white areas in the county would both be considered lacking diversity.
Diversity Score
Chugach Census Area Diversity Score
98
With a diversity score of 98 out of 100, Chugach Census Area is much more diverse than other US counties. The most diverse area within Chugach Census Area's proper boundaries is to the central of the county. The least diverse areas are located in the northeast parts of Chugach Census Area.
